Introduction to the Community Action Commission
The Community Action Commission of Erie, Huron & Richland Counties, Inc. is a dedicated non-profit organization committed to addressing poverty and promoting self-sufficiency within Erie, Huron, and Richland Counties in Ohio. Established to serve as a vital resource for vulnerable populations, the Commission operates with a core mission of empowering individuals and families to overcome barriers to economic stability and improve their overall quality of life. Specialties and Services
The Community Action Commissionâs focus is broad, encompassing a range of initiatives designed to tackle the root causes of poverty. Key areas of operation include:
- Energy Assistance: Providing crucial support to low-income households struggling to afford their energy bills, ensuring they can maintain comfortable and safe living conditions.
- Housing Support: Offering assistance with housing security, including rental assistance programs, eviction prevention services, and resources for finding affordable housing options.
- Weatherization Programs: Improving the energy efficiency of homes, reducing utility costs, and enhancing the health and safety of residents through weatherization upgrades.
- Family Support Services: Supporting families with childcare assistance, parenting education, and resources to strengthen family stability.
- Financial Literacy Training: Equipping individuals with the knowledge and skills needed to manage their finances effectively, build savings, and achieve financial independence.
-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) Assistance: Providing support and guidance to individuals applying for and accessing SNAP benefits.
